Essential Components of Personal Injury Law To Consider

Comprehending personal injury law is crucial for anyone engaged in an accident, as it includes the legal rights and choices open to victims seeking compensation. One key aspect is negligence, which refers to the failure to exercise reasonable care, resulting in harm to another party. Victims must establish that the other party was negligent to claim damages.

Additionally, the principle of liability serves a vital role; determining who is at fault can influence the level of compensation granted. Understanding the statute of limitations is essential as well; it establishes the time frame within which a victim can submit a claim.

Ultimately, the forms of damages available include economic, such as medical costs and lost wages, and non-economic, such as pain and suffering. Understanding with these elements empowers accident victims to move through the legal landscape efficiently and pursue the compensation they merit.

Gathering Eyewitness Statements

Collecting witness statements is a crucial step in constructing a strong personal injury case. A personal injury lawyer systematically identifies and interviews people who saw the incident. This process typically begins at the scene of the accident, where witnesses can provide prompt accounts of what happened. Lawyers may use photographs or videos to refresh the memories of witnesses, ensuring thorough and accurate statements. They also document contact information for follow-up and verification. By employing effective questioning techniques, the lawyer captures crucial facts and perspectives that support the client's claims. These statements can greatly reinforce the case, providing supporting evidence that may influence negotiations or testify in court. In the end, meticulous witness gathering enhances the overall strength of the personal injury claim.

Gathering Medical Records

Whereas the collection of medical records is a essential aspect of constructing a personal injury case, it requires meticulous coordination and attention to detail. A personal injury lawyer usually begins by obtaining the necessary authorizations from the client, providing access to relevant medical history. They systematically reach out to healthcare providers to request documents, including diagnostic reports, treatment notes, and billing statements. This process often involves thorough follow-up to confirm timely receipt of records, which can be essential in establishing the extent of injuries and associated costs. Additionally, lawyers analyze the collected records to construct a compelling narrative that links the injuries directly to the incident, reinforcing the case for maximum compensation. This comprehensive approach to gathering evidence is vital for success.

Understanding Insurance Tactics

Comprehending the methods utilized by insurance companies is crucial for increasing compensation in personal injury cases. Insurance companies often use approaches such as lowball offers, delays, and information gathering to reduce payouts. They may try to understate the extent of injuries or shift blame to the victim, which can undermine the negotiation process. A personal injury lawyer is proficient in countering these strategies, employing comprehensive documentation and expert testimonies to bolster the case. Negotiation plays a vital role, as competent lawyers can fight for fair compensation by presenting convincing evidence and articulating the full impact of injuries on the victim's life. This approach enables individuals to confront insurance adjusters with confidence, ultimately leading to more favorable settlements.

Avoid Falling Into These Common Personal Injury Case Pitfalls

Managing a personal injury claim can be complicated, and many common pitfalls can obstruct a successful outcome. One critical mistake occurs when claimants underestimate their injuries, leading to inadequate documentation and compensation. Additionally, failing to seek swift medical attention can undermine a case, as gaps in treatment may generate doubts about the extent of the injury.

A frequent mistake involves discussing the case with insurance adjusters without legal representation, leading to misinterpretation or undervaluation of the claim. Additionally, providing recorded statements can be detrimental if the claimant is not fully aware of the consequences.

Claimants must also avoid rushing to settle, as initial offers may not reflect the true value of their damages. Finally, neglecting to adhere to deadlines for filing claims can result in lost opportunities for compensation. By understanding these common mistakes, claimants can more effectively manage their injury cases and safeguard their interests.

What Are the Standard Fees for a Personal Injury Lawyer?

Hiring a personal injury lawyer usually costs between 25% to 40% of the compensation amount. Numerous lawyers work on a contingency fee basis, which means they only get paid if the case is won.

Am I Still Able to Claim Compensation if I Was Partly at Fault?

Compensation claims remain possible for individuals who are partially at fault. In various jurisdictions, comparative negligence laws allow recovery, adapting the compensation depending on the level of fault assigned to each party participating in the incident.

What Categories of Damages Can a Personal Injury Lawyer Help Secure?

A personal injury lawyer can assist in recovering multiple types of damages, including medical expenses, lost wages, physical pain and suffering, emotional distress, and property loss, ensuring clients receive just compensation for their sustained injuries and losses.

How Long Will My Personal Injury Case Take to Settle?

A personal injury lawsuit typically requires a few months to several years to reach resolution. Elements including the complexity of the case, negotiation speed, and court schedules determine the timeline, determining how rapidly settlement compensation is reached.

Is My Case Headed for Trial or an Out-of-Court Settlement?

If a case goes to trial or settles out of court hinges on numerous factors, including evidence strength and negotiation outcomes. Many cases are resolved without trial, but some might require trial for resolution.
